内容へ移動
猫型iPS細胞研究所
ユーザ用ツール
ログイン
サイト用ツール
検索
ツール
文書の表示
以前のリビジョン
バックリンク
最近の変更
メディアマネージャー
サイトマップ
ログイン
>
最近の変更
メディアマネージャー
サイトマップ
現在位置:
INDEX
»
reactnative
»
react-navigation
トレース:
reactnative:react-navigation
この文書は読取専用です。文書のソースを閲覧することは可能ですが、変更はできません。もし変更したい場合は管理者に連絡してください。
====== react-navigation====== ====== インストール ====== <code> npm install --save react-navigation </code> ===== イベント ===== 下記イベントリスナーを追加したコンポーネントントは、フォーカス時やフォーカスを外れたときにイベントを実行できる。 navigationの「←」でもイベントは発生する。 <code> async componentDidMount(e){ this.props.navigation.addListener('didFocus', () => console.log('didFocus')) this.props.navigation.addListener('didBlur', () => console.log('didBlur')) } </code> ↓も同じ [[https://reactnavigation.org/docs/en/navigation-events.html|NavigationEvents reference]] イベントを発生させたいコンポーネントのViewの下に追加すればいい。(importが必要) <code> import { NavigationEvents } from 'react-navigation' return ( <View style={styles.view}> <NavigationEvents onWillFocus={() => console.log('will focus')} onDidFocus={() => console.log('did focus')} onWillBlur={() => console.log('will blur')} onDidBlur={() => console.log('did blur')} /> </code>
reactnative/react-navigation.txt
· 最終更新: 2019/03/08 06:20 by
ips
ページ用ツール
文書の表示
以前のリビジョン
バックリンク
文書の先頭へ